Frequently asked questions

What services does MindWorks actually deliver?

The firm delivers enterprise IT services across five main lines: database administration, IT outsourcing, hybrid and multicloud management, cybersecurity, and infrastructure and storage. It also provides connectivity for voice and data and runs a corporate training division, making it an operational technology outsourcer rather than an investment entity.

Is MindWorks a family office or an operating company?

MindWorks is structured as an operating IT-services company with no disclosed investment vehicle, external capital pool, or wealth-origin link to a single family. It lists 150 employees serving over 200 corporate and government clients in Brazil and does not publicly describe managing third-party or proprietary investment capital.

Where does MindWorks operate geographically?

Operations are concentrated in southeast and central-west Brazil. The firm identifies a primary presence in Espírito Santo — its home state — with additional coverage in Minas Gerais, São Paulo, Rio de Janeiro, and Goiânia. No international offices or cross-border delivery capabilities have been disclosed.

Which sectors does MindWorks serve?

The firm serves public-sector and industrial accounts. Specific named clients include the Municipal Government of Vila Velha, Cesan (the Espírito Santo water and sanitation utility), and ArcelorMittal Tubarão, the flat-steel production unit. Its broader client base is described only as exceeding 200 organizations across Brazil.

How does MindWorks deliver its cybersecurity capability?

Cybersecurity is listed as a core service line alongside cloud and infrastructure, and one published case study details a Fortinet deployment for the Municipality of Vila Velha. Beyond that implementation reference, the firm does not publicly disclose its cybersecurity methodology, specific tooling stack, or security operations center architecture.

Does MindWorks maintain partnerships with technology vendors?

The firm's website references a dedicated 'Partners' section, but no specific technology or channel partners are named publicly. The Fortinet case study for Vila Velha implies at least a reseller or integrator relationship with that vendor, though no formal partnership tier or status has been published.
